    Global Health Exhibition 2025 expands footprint amid rising global interest

    The Global Health Exhibition (GHE) will return to Riyadh from October 27–30, 2025, under the patronage of Saudi Arabia’s Ministry of Health and supported by Vision 2030 and the Kingdom’s Health Sector Transformation Program. Organised by Tahaluf, the event will take place at the Riyadh Exhibition and Convention Centre and is set to be the largest edition to date.

    Unprecedented global interest and investment momentum

    Driven by Saudi Arabia’s expanding influence in global healthcare and investor confidence in its transformation agenda, GHE 2025 will feature more than 2,000 exhibiting brands and 500 speakers. Global healthcare leaders such as Zimmer Biomed, GE HealthCare, Novo Nordisk, Paxera Health, Davita, and Samsung are confirmed to participate.

    To accommodate growing international demand, GHE 2025 has increased its floor space by 40 per cent, adding three new exhibition halls. The event will host 20 international pavilions, up from 12 in 2024, with participation confirmed from the USA, China, Germany, the UK, South Korea, and others.

    Spotlighting real-world transformation at the Leaders Summit

    The 2025 edition will host the Leaders Summit, uniting global healthcare stakeholders—from ministers and regulators to Fortune 500 executives and VCs—to discuss policy implementation and digital innovation.

    Some of the speakers include:

    • Dr. David Rhew, Global Chief Medical Officer and VP of Healthcare, Microsoft (USA), an authority in clinical AI and health innovation.
    • Baroness Nicola Blackwood, Chair, Genomics England and Former UK Minister of Health, known for shaping NHS data and digital transformation policies.
    • Dr. Katharina Grimm, Head of Medical, FIFA, spearheading global athlete health and performance medicine initiatives.

    New in 2025: VIBE, powered by LiveWell

    Launching alongside GHE is VIBE, powered by LiveWell, a dedicated wellness event aligned with the Ministry of Health’s LiveWell initiative. With Saudi Arabia’s wellness economy valued at $19bn, VIBE will promote personalised, preventative care and lifestyle solutions through business collaboration and community engagement.

    With national investment accelerating across digital health, regulation, and public-private partnerships, the Global Health Exhibition is fast emerging as a global hub for healthcare innovation and investment.
